Applications
4-Hexen-1-ol, 5-methyl-2-(1-methylethylidene)-, dihydro deriv. (CAS 62288-68-0) is typically used as an intermediate and component in fragrance chemistry and related aroma applications, functioning as an odorant or fixative in fragrance formulations such as perfumes and aroma compounds. In cosmetics and personal care, it may serve as a fragrance ingredient or processing aid to modulate scent profiles. In household and cleaning products, it can act as a fragrance additive and, in some cases, as a lightweight solvent for formulation purposes. In polymers/plastics and coatings/inks, it may be used as a building block for chemically related compounds or as a processing aid or aroma-related modifier in polymer or coating formulations. Actual usage depends on local regulations and formulation limits.
